Scope: all roles, including approved backfills; internal transfers require VP sign-off. Rationale: divisional revenue missed plan two consecutive quarters; cost base must contract before the Renwick product refresh. Contractors end at current terms; no extensions. Exceptions route through the People Committee; expect few. Review date: end of next quarter. Managers must not discuss outside this group. The board should read the following note before Thursday's session.

board note of fahap-yafop: Headcount on the Istion team goes from 50 to 73 by the end of September. Gross margin on Istion came in at 33 percent against a plan of 28 percent.

### Changelog 3.2.0 — Setting renamed

Heads up, plugin folks: the old `SCANWIRE_KEY` setting is gone. The Beepline barcode bridge now reads a differently named variable, so update your `.env` files before upgrading or scans will bounce. Everything else is untouched. The renamed credential line should sit right here at the top of the file.

sealed setting: ARCHIVE_KEY3=8d0

## Releases

The flaky-DNS fix for the Norrel resolver shim ships as signed tarballs only. Plugin authors: pin to a release tag, never to main — the retry logic changed twice and unsigned snapshots will not load in host apps. Each release includes a checksum file and a detached signature. Verify before distributing your plugin with the fix bundled. All release artifacts are verified against the signing key below.

rollout seal: bky4_DFM9

## BannerGate — Environments

The consent banner service runs in three isolated environments: dev, staging, and production, each with separate signing material and no shared state. Rollout gating is controlled per-environment; production changes require dual approval under the Varnholt policy. The production environment currently runs with the configuration values listed below.

service settings:
PRAIX_LOG_LEVEL=error
PRAIX_METRICS_HOST=metrics.praix.qorvelcorp.corp
PRAIX_POOL_SIZE=16